body {	
	font-family: Arial, Helvetica, sans-serifM;
	background-color:#fff;
	text-align:center;
	}


/** Global **/
* {
    margin:0;
    padding:0;
	border:0;
	text-align:left;
	}


.off, .span {
	position: absolute;
    top: -9999px;
	left:-9999px;
	}
	
.clear {
	clear:both;
	}
	
hr {
	height:1px;
	width:849px;
	margin:15px 0;
	border-bottom:1px solid #4D4D4D;
	}
	
a {color:#F28F01;}

h2 {font-size:16px;}
	
/** end global **/

/*********************************/
/***** CONTENITORE GENERALE ******/
/*********************************/

#contenitore {
width:950px;
margin:0 auto;
}

/*********************************/
/*********** HEADER **************/
/*********************************/

/*********** LINGUA **************/

#lingua {
	width:950px;
	margin:0 auto;
	height:26px;
	background:url(http://www.mvm.it/ita/img/lingue.png) no-repeat left;
	}

#lingua ul {
position: relative;
height:18px;
top:7px;
text-align:left;
}

#lingua ul li {
list-style: none;
position: absolute;
}

#lingua ul li a {
height: 12px;
display: block;
text-indent: -9999px;
outline: none;
-moz-outline: none;
text-decoration: none;
}

#mn1 {left: 838px; width: 24px;}
#mn2 {left: 872px; width: 24px;}


/*********************************/

#testata {
width:950px;
border-top:1px solid #fff;
}

#menu {
margin:0 0 0 50px;
border-bottom:2px solid #ececec;
}	
	
#menu ul li {
padding:5px 0 0 10px;
list-style:none;
display:inline;
	}	
	
#menu ul li a, #menu ul li a:hover {
font-size:15px;
font-weight:bold;
text-decoration:none;
color:#989C9F;
	}
	
#menu ul li a.news {
font-size:11px;
margin-left:15px;
color:#F28F01;
	}
	
#menu ul li a:hover {
color:#C0C0C0;
}	

#menu ul li.selezionato a {
color:#C0C0C0;
}	
	
.menu_interno {
padding:10px 0;
}

.menu_interno a {
color:#F28F01;
text-decoration:underline;
font-size:15px;
}

.menu_interno a:hover {
color:#333;
text-decoration:none;
}

table td {padding:10px;}

input {border:1px solid #ededed;background-color:#ccc;font-size:10px;color:white;}
	
#colonna_sx, #colonna_sx_libera {
width:470px;
margin:25px 0 0 25px;
color:#999;
float:left;
font-size:12px;
line-height:15px;
}

#colonna_sx_libera {
width:928px;
margin:0 0 0 25px;
}


#colonna_sx_libera img {
padding:3px;
border:1px solid #ccc;
float:left;
margin:0 10px 10px 0;
}

#colonna_sx_libera h2 {
margin-bottom:10px;
font-size:16px;
}

#colonna_sx p, #colonna_sx_libera p {
margin-bottom:10px;
}	


#colonna_dx  {
margin-left:450px;
margin-top:20px;
}	

.testo_dx  {
color:#999;
float:right;
font-size:12px;
line-height:15px;
margin:5px 0 0 0 ;
}

.img_dx {
float:right;
}

.clear_dx {
clear:right;
}

.foto_dx {
border:1px solid #ccc;
margin:15px 20px 0 0;
float:right;
}

.menu_interno a.selezionato {
font-size:16px;
color:#999;
text-decoration:none;
font-weight:bold;
}

#colonna_sx_libera img.logo_home {border:0; float:right;margin:-3px 0 0 0;}

#banner_events {
	border-left:2px solid #ccc;
	width:450px;
	float:right;
	padding:0 0 0 34px;
	margin:0 11px 0 0;
	voice-family: "\"}\""; 
	voice-family:inherit;
	width:416px;
	}

#banner {
	width:450px;
	padding:0 0 0 34px;
	margin:0;
	voice-family: "\"}\""; 
	voice-family:inherit;
	width:416px;
	}


/*********************************/
/********** SLIDER **************/
/*******************************/

#scroll_news {
	height:100px!important;
}

#nav {
position: relative;
float: right;
top: 61px;
right: 8px;
}
#nav li { width: 55px; float: left; margin-left: -41px; list-style: none }
#nav a { background-image: url('./img/state_b.gif'); height:20px; width:20px; background-repeat:no-repeat; display:block; text-indent:-9999px;  }
#nav li.activeSlide a { background-image: url('./img/state_a.gif'); height:20px; width:20px;  background-repeat:no-repeat; display:block; text-indent:-9999px;}

/*********************************/
/***** FOOTER ******/
/*********************************/

#footer {
	width:900px;
	margin:15px auto;
	font-size:10px;
	color:#999;
	text-align:center;
	}
